On our English PGCE course, you can gain the knowledge and skills to become an inspiring, fully-qualified English teacher./p>This PGCE in English, which has been recognised as 'outstanding' by Ofsted, will give you the opportunity to explore all aspects of English teaching./p>You'll work with curriculum in a stimulating and exciting way, covering topics such as:/p>Shakespeare/li>poetry/li>the novel/li>drama, media and multi-modal approaches/li>As you work towards gaining your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) as an English teacher, you’ll develop the theory and practical techniques to teach English to all secondary school pupils./p>You'll build on your existing knowledge of English language and literature, through the course's theoretical foundations and practical focus, and learn the most effective methods for helping young people to:/p>become fluent readers and writers/li>improve their vocabulary and use of grammar/li>understand and enjoy English literature/li>explain, listen and debate/li>Your training will also teach you essential skills such as:/p>managing the classroom/li>monitoring and assessing pupils/li>teaching inclusively so you can meet the needs of all students in your classroom/li>You'll spend at least 120 days in placement schools located in our partnership area, which covers Southampton, Hampshire, Wiltshire, Dorset, and the Isle of Wight. Here you’ll observe lessons and work with small groups of pupils, before gradually being introduced to whole-class teaching. /p>You’ll have the support of a school-based mentor and a university-based tutor throughout your placements./p>In addition to the QTS needed to teach in secondary schools in England, Wales and across the world, you'll complete our English PGCE course with a master's-level Postgraduate Certificate of Education./p>

Entry requirements

To be eligible, you must hold a 2:2 UK honours degree (or equivalent) in English or a related subject, along with GCSEs in English language and mathematics at a minimum grade of 4/C.
